Love Note's Story

Meet mischeivious sprite, Love Note! Lovey is always interested in what youre doing, and eager to at least try to help out. Especially when food is being cooked! She's a bit of an adventurous foodie herself, and always wants to taste test what you have. Shes a big fan of the leafy greens her bunny foster siblings get and loves nibbling on mustard greens occasionally. Shes affectionate but independent and loves exploring and relaxing with her people just as much! She likes to sleep on your legs and likes you to hold her paw when she sticks it out to you from her cat tree. She actually smiles by scrunching up her wittle face when getting head pets, and has a quiet but rapid purr that conveys her excitement of quality time with her person. She doesnt mind being held, and is more of a shared space gal than an in-your-lap gal. But it does happen here and there! When shes feeling extra lovey-dovey, she will give you a small love bite and shake her head while doing so. She's telling you she thinks youre a delicious snack!<br/><br/>Lovey is great with respectful dogs and cats, and shes super playful! We think it would be a disservice to send her home to a home without another playful cat because of her silly side, but if someone is home all the time with lots of time for enriching play, that may work. In that case, we hope that person would be open to a second cat (or more) for her in the future. <br/><br/>Lovey is a FIP survivor! She is treasured in her foster home where she arrived as a skinny, scared, feral kitten and has blossomed into a goofy, zippy, nibbly princess. She has overcome so much and deserves a doting home where she can continue to provide and recieve laughs and love every day. 3

Feline Fine Cat Rescue's Adoption Policy
To be considered for adoption, you must: *Be 21 years or older *Live locally (within an 2.5 hour drive of the Chicagoland suburbs) *Have a valid license/ID with your current address *Submit an adoption application (found on our website) *Be head of household (or have head of household present at adoption) *Have all family members/roommates aware and in favor of adoption *Renters are required to provide valid contact info for landlord/management company & have copy of lease clause regarding pet policies
